使用 Visual Studio Code 進行遠端開發
速覽
-
層級
-
技能
-
角色
遠端開發提供各種優點如一致的環境、使用更強大硬體的能力,以及在不同平台上開發的彈性,而不會影響本機電腦。 Visual Studio Code 提供適用於各種遠端開發設定的工具,例如使用容器、遠端電腦或 Windows 子系統 Linux 版 (WSL)。 在此路徑中,您將:
- 了解 Visual Studio Code 中可用的不同遠端開發供應項目。
- 練習開始使用每個遠端開發供應項目。
- 探索個人化您自己的遠端開發工作流程的秘訣。
必要條件
- 對 Visual Studio Code 編輯器有基本了解,例如了解如何安裝延伸模組
- 軟體開發的基本知識,例如編輯和執行程式碼,以及使用 GitHub 等原始檔控制提供者
成就代碼
您要請求成就代碼嗎?
此學習路徑中的課程模組
使用 Visual Studio Code 開發容器延伸模組,取得、建立及設定容器型開發環境
在本課程模組中,您將了解如何針對 Web 使用 Visual Studio 從瀏覽器相容的任何裝置進行開發。 我們將探索如何針對 Web 使用 Visual Studio Code 進行輕量型程式碼編輯和檢閱。 最後,我們將了解如何在不同的環境中繼續工作,以取得 Visual Studio Code的完整功能集。
使用 Visual Studio Code 啟用遠端通道存取。
在本課程模組中,您將了解如何使用 Visual Studio Code Remote - SSH 延伸模組,順暢地在遠端電腦上進行開發。 我們將探索如何使用 Visual Studio Code 的完整功能集,在本機執行和偵錯位於遠端電腦上的程式碼。
在本課程模組中,您將了解如何使用 Windows 子系統 Linux 版 (WSL) 搭配 Visual Studio Code (VS Code)。 我們會探索使用 WSL 的安裝流程和基本概念。 此外,我們會安裝及利用 Visual Studio Code WSL 延伸模組。 最後,我們會示範如何在 WSL 環境內的 VS Code 中偵錯和執行 Python 程式碼。
注意
本課程模組包含 Windows 子系統 Linux 版 (WSL) 上的入門。 如需深入了解 WSL,請參閱什麼是 Windows 子系統 Linux 版?。
在本課程模組中,您將了解如何針對遠端開發環境自訂 Visual Studio Code。 我們會探索如何備份您的 Visual Studio Code 設定,以便不論使用 Visual Studio Code 的位置為何,您都能夠取得自己的個人化體驗。 我們也會檢查如何使用 Visual Studio Code 中的設定檔,以載入各種遠端設定和專案的自訂開發環境。